Key Components of Diesel Generators Diesel generators consist of several key components that work together to generate electrical power. These components include: - Diesel engine: The heart of the generator, the diesel engine is responsible for converting diesel fuel into mechanical energy. - Alternator: The alternator is connected to the diesel engine and converts the mechanical energy into electrical energy. - Fuel system: The fuel system delivers diesel fuel to the engine to power the generator. - Cooling system: The cooling system helps regulate the temperature of the engine to prevent overheating. - Exhaust system: The exhaust system removes harmful gases produced during the combustion process. - Control panel: The control panel allows operators to monitor and control the generator's operation. 3.
